Understanding the mechanics of meal timing requires a look at circadian biology, the internal daily clock that governs human hormone production and digestion. During daytime hours, insulin sensitivity tends to be higher, allowing the body to clear glucose from the bloodstream efficiently. As darkness approaches, the brain secretes melatonin to prepare the body for rest, a process that simultaneously slows digestive motility and dampens insulin response. Consuming a large, carbohydrate-dense dinner late in the evening can therefore lead to prolonged spikes in blood sugar, promoting fat storage rather than calorie burning.

LATE EVENING DINING AND METABOLIC SLOWDOWN

Research into chronological nutrition shows that late-night dining creates a physiological mismatch between metabolic capacity and energy intake. When food arrives in the stomach during hours traditionally reserved for sleep, liver enzymes and gastrointestinal tract tissues operate at reduced efficiency. The body prioritizes immediate glucose storage over glycogen depletion, which can stall weight loss efforts even if a person remains within their daily caloric intake target. This finding challenges the old dietary adage that a calorie is simply a calorie regardless of when it is consumed.

Furthermore, late meals frequently disrupt the quality of deep sleep, which plays a crucial role in regulating hunger hormones for the following day. Poor sleep lowers levels of leptin, the hormone that signals fullness, while increasing levels of ghrelin, the hormone that stimulates appetite. As a result, individuals who consistently eat late dinners often experience heightened cravings for high-fat and high-sugar foods the next morning. This creates a compounding cycle of delayed meals, poor sleep quality, and increased energy intake that hampers long-term fitness goals.

THE THREE HOUR RULE AND EARLY SUPPER TIME

To optimize metabolic function, health experts cited by the Evening Standard recommend finishing the day's final meal at least three to four hours before going to bed. For an individual who usually turns off the lights at eleven in the evening, an ideal dinner window falls between six and seven at night. This buffer allows the stomach to empty, lowers circulating blood sugar, and permits insulin levels to return to a resting baseline before the body enters its nocturnal repair phase. It also gives the digestive system ample time to process nutrients without interrupting sleep cycles.

Adopting an earlier dinner schedule aligns closely with time-restricted feeding, a popular form of intermittent fasting that limits daily food intake to an eight or ten-hour window. By extending the overnight fast from the end of dinner to breakfast the next morning, the body naturally exhausts its store of readily available glucose. Once glucose reserves drop, the liver begins breaking down stored body fat for fuel, a state known as lipolysis. An early dinner effectively lengthens this fat-burning window without requiring extreme dietary restrictions or caloric starvation during daytime hours.

RESTAURANT INDUSTRY ADAPTATIONS TO SHIFTING PATTERNS

The growing public interest in earlier dining windows is already creating ripple effects across the restaurant sector. Establishments that historically relied on late-evening seatings between eight and ten at night are noticing a distinct shift toward early-evening reservations. Operators in major metropolitan areas report that prime reservation slots now lean heavily toward five-thirty and six-thirty in the evening. Guests are increasingly seeking menus that offer lighter, easily digestible fare that fits comfortably into a early evening routine.

To cater to these changing habits, progressive operators are adjusting their service strategies and kitchen prep schedules. Some dining establishments are introducing early-bird tasting menus or happy hour dining concepts designed specifically for guests seeking a complete meal before seven at night. Kitchens are also expanding options for fiber-rich vegetables and lean proteins while offering smaller portion sizes for late-night bar menus. These operational pivots allow restaurants to maximize turnover during earlier hours while meeting the wellness preferences of modern consumers.

For consumers looking to adjust their evening routine, consistency is more important than drastic overnight changes. Experts advise moving the dinner hour forward by thirty minutes every few days to allow social schedules and hunger cues to adapt gradually. Planning evening meals around protein and complex carbohydrates can also help maintain satiety throughout the night, preventing the urge to snack late in the evening. Drinking water or herbal tea after dinner can help manage psychological cravings during the post-dinner digestive period.

Social commitments and work schedules can occasionally make an early dinner difficult to maintain. On nights when late dining is unavoidable, choosing lighter options such as broths, leafy greens, and grilled seafood can minimize digestive stress. Avoiding heavy cream sauces, fried foods, and refined sugars during late meals helps prevent severe glucose spikes before bed. Flexibility remains key to sustaining these habits without compromising social life or professional engagements.
